We learn today, to no one’s great surprise, that Volition, Inc. is working on a fourth Saints Row game, apparently for PlayStation 3, Xbox 360, and PC platforms. The sort-of-confirmation comes from a LinkedIn profile for a Volition game designer, as spotted by the gaming Internet’s super-sleuth, Superannuation (via Polygon). The Saints Row 4 shout has since been edited out of the profile.

Lost Planet 3 is no longer the only upcoming game set in Capcom’s sci-fi universe; it is now joined by EX Troopers, which Famitsu reveals (via Andriasang) is coming to PlayStation 3 and Nintendo 3DS. The game features an anime-inspired visual style, a marked change from the more realistic look of the core Lost Planet games.
